Analyzing customer feedback can provide feedback on their customers’ needs and preferences. The process of analyzing customer feedback starts by collecting the feedback. This can be done by surveying customers directly, gathering data from social media or other online sources, or using customer service feedback. Once the input is collected, it can be grouped according to topics or themes. Then, the feedback can be analyzed to identify trends, strengths and weaknesses, and areas for improvement. Finally, the data can inform decisions about product and service design, marketing campaigns, customer service, etc.
